Genesis 2 does not tell us much more about the significance of this seventh day. But as we learn more about it from Scripture we realize that the “rest” involved was not a lazy rest. Rather, it was intended to be a day when the working man could enjoy the Creator as well as the creation. He could devote himself more directly to fellowship with God and the worship of His Name. This “sabbath,” or “rest-day,” was a further special blessing which God gave to man so he would be refreshed and strengthened, encouraged and heartened by contemplating all that God had done and stimulated to worship God in response.
Sinclair Ferguson

Turkey-sausage Puff

INGREDIENTS

1 lb Bulk sausage
1/2 c Onion, minced
1 c Celer, diced
2 Eggs, beaten
1 c Milk
2 c Soft breadcrumbs
1 t Poultry seasoning
3 c Turkey gravy
2 c Turkey, cooked & diced
Salt & pepper to taste

INSTRUCTIONS

Cook the sausage over moderate heat until nearly done but not browned,
breaking the meat apart with a fork. Pour off the fat, leaving about  2
Tbsp in the pan; add the onion and celery and continue cooking for
about 5 minutes. Combine the beaten eggs, milk, breadcrumbs, poultry
seasoning and 1 cup of the garvy. Stir in the turkey. Taste and add
salt and pepper as needed. Stir in the sausage mixture, turn into a
greased 10 x 7 inch baking pan, and bake in a 350 degree oven for
about 45 minutes, or until set and browned.  Remove from the oven and
let stand 10 minutes. Serve with the remaining gravy, heated.  An
extremely tasty way to use leftover turkey or chicken.  From - THE
LADIES AID COOKBOOK by Beatrice Vaughan. Pub by The Stephen  Greene
Press, Brattleboro, Vermont. 1971  Shared by Robert Rostrup  From
